verb Street Slang

Dump

· verb · nyc

Empty a clip — fire a gun, usually all of it.

Definitions

1

To fire a gun, usually unloading multiple rounds. 'Dumping' is volume — you're not aiming carefully, you're tipping the whole magazine in someone's direction.

“He dumped on the block and skated off before anyone hit the ground.”

2

To break up with someone. Standard non-violent meaning — you discarded them.

“She dumped him over a text. Brutal.”

3

To take a dump — defecate. The crudest sense, but it's there.

“Hold the meeting, I gotta dump real quick.”

Origin & Usage

AAVE; gun sense is staple drill/trap vocabulary, derived from the image of dumping the contents of a magazine.
